Computer
Science
A Level
Course Overview
Interested in what makes computers tick? Want an introduction to computing?
If you like solving problems and you can think logically then Computer Science is the subject for you.
You are given the opportunity to study current computer applications; high level language programming and systems analysis and design. Computing combines well with all Sciences, Mathematics, Product Design, Interactive Media and many other subjects.
Course Topics
- Problem Solving
- Programming Techniques
- Computational Thinking
- Thinking Logically
- Data Types
- Algorithms
- Data Structures
- Data Transmission
- The Internet and Web Technologies
- Data Encryption and Compression
- Databases
- Legal, Ethical, Moral and Social Issues
- Software Development
- Analysing Requirements
- Designing Solution
- Building and Testing Applications
- Evaluating Solutions

Course Features
Learn how to write programs using programming languages and write your own simple games.
Learn problem solving techniques which allow you to break the problem into small, manageable pieces.
Apply what you learnt to develop the skills to solve problems, design systems and understand human and machine intelligence.
Clear progression into higher education.
ASSESSMENT
- Exam: 100%
- Awarding Body: OCR
Results
- 100% A*-C grades last year
- Almost 70% high grades last year.
Where Courses Become Careers
Students who take this subject may study Engineering, Software Engineering, Computing Science, Games Technology, Information Technology, Information Systems and many other subjects.
